Output d9185f40ecd08badc9f3fc88f3113b01231abdab9fc11deb6b834835f41ddeef:4

value
5960274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7277fd24e1c48604d6812fcc89e30da77262fd00 OP_EQUAL
address
3C8GhPCDZNKFt2TymVTZkNiU3DavpcbPYE
transaction
d9185f40ecd08badc9f3fc88f3113b01231abdab9fc11deb6b834835f41ddeef
confirmations
362154
spent
true